The Intel Xeon Platinum 8360H features 24 processor cores and has the capability to manage 48 threads concurrently.
It was released in Q2/2020 and belongs to the 3 generation of the Intel Xeon Platinum series.
To use the Intel Xeon Platinum 8360H, you'll need a motherboard with a LGA 4189 socket.

CPU Cores and Base Frequency

The Intel Xeon Platinum 8360H has 24 CPU cores and can calculate 48 threads in parallel.
The clock frequency of the Intel Xeon Platinum 8360H is 3.0 GHz
and turbo frequency for one core is 4.2 GHz.
The number of CPU cores greatly affects the speed of the processor and is an important performance indicator.
